    * CAMEL-24293: fix empty-directory extraction tests and document the 
CamelFileName hardening
    
    Unmarshalling now sets CamelFileName to the stripped entry base name 
(Tar/Zip
    Slip prevention), so the tar/zip empty-directory tests can no longer 
rebuild the
    archive's directory layout from CamelFileName — getParentFile() was null 
for the
    stripped directory entry, causing an NPE. Rebuild the structure from the 
full
    entry name that is still exposed on a dedicated header 
(CamelTarFileEntryName for
    tar, zipFileName for zip). Add a 4.22 upgrade-guide entry describing the 
change
    and the header to use for structure-aware extraction.

+=== camel-tarfile / camel-zipfile - CamelFileName is stripped to the entry 
base name on unmarshal
+
+When unmarshalling a tar or zip archive, the `CamelFileName` header was 
previously set to the
+raw archive entry name, which for a crafted archive can contain path segments 
(e.g.
+`../../etc/passwd`). If a downstream route wrote the message to disk using 
that header, the
+entry name could escape the intended directory (Tar Slip / Zip Slip).
+
+`CamelFileName` is now set to the entry's base name only (path segments 
stripped) for both the
+data format and the iterator/splitter modes. The full, unmodified entry name 
remains available
+so routes that intentionally recreate the archive's directory structure keep 
working — read it
+from `CamelTarFileEntryName` for tar and from `zipFileName` for zip instead of 
`CamelFileName`.
